最近三个月我几乎每天都在用AI编程工具写代码,先后深度使用了Claude Code、Cursor和GitHub Copilot。有些感受不吐不快。
先说结论:没有最好的工具,只有最适合你当前场景的工具。但如果你是独立开发者,我有一些具体的建议。
为什么这次对比值得看
市面上大部分AI编程工具的对比文章都是泛泛而谈,作者可能只用了一两个小时就写评测了。我这篇不一样。我用这三个工具完成了一个完整的SaaS项目,包含前端React、后Node.js API、数据库设计和部署脚本。前后大概写了2万多行代码,每个工具都承担了相当一部分工作。
Claude Code:终端里的重度搭档
Claude Code是Anthropic自家的命令行编程工具。它不是插件,不是IDE,就在终端里跑。
优势很明显。它能理解整个项目的上下文,不是只看当前文件。我在重构一个有40多个文件的Express项目时,它能准确找到所有需要修改的地方。这种跨文件的代码理解能力,目前是三者中最强的。
另一个让我惊喜的是它的自主性。你给它一个任务描述,比如”给用户模块加上邮箱验证功能”,它会自己规划步骤,创建文件,修改路由,甚至帮你写测试。整个过程你只需要review结果。
但缺点也明显。它需要你比较熟悉命令行操作。没有图形界面,对习惯VS Code的人来说有学习成本。另外Anthropic的API定价不便宜,重度使用一个月下来费用不低。
根据Anthropic 2025年第四季度的数据,Claude系列模型在代码生成基准测试SWE-bench上的通过率达到了71.7%,这个数字在2026年初又有所提升。实际项目中的体感确实印证了这个数据,复杂逻辑的生成质量是三者中最好的。
Cursor:VS Code Fork的AI原生体验
Cursor可能是目前对开发者最友好的AI编程工具。它基于VS Code魔改,你之前的插件、快捷键、主题都能直接用,迁移成本几乎为零。
它的Composer功能可以同时编辑多个文件。你在侧边栏描述需求,它在编辑器里直接给你标注改动,接受或拒绝都很直观。这个交互设计确实比纯命令行要友好太多。
Cursor有个Tab自动补全功能我特别喜欢。它不只是补全当前行的代码,还能根据你刚才的编辑模式预测你接下来要写的几行。有时候感觉它在读我的心思。
不过Cursor的多文件理解能力比Claude Code弱一些。当项目结构比较复杂时,它偶尔会给出不符合现有代码风格的建议。还有一点,Cursor默认使用的是Anthropic和OpenAI的模型,所以你实际上是在为底层模型的API调用付费,Cursor自己再收一层订阅费。
GitHub Copilot:生态优势仍然在
GitHub Copilot是最早火起来的AI编程工具,2021年就发布了。到2026年,它已经迭代了很多代。
它最大的优势是生态。深度集成GitHub,理解你的仓库历史,能参考issue和PR里的讨论。如果你主要在GitHub上做开发,这种原生集成的体验是另外两个工具给不了的。
最近的Copilot版本加了Agent模式,可以自主完成一些多步骤任务。老实说,这个功能的成熟度还不如Claude Code,但方向是对的。
价格方面Copilot是最便宜的,个人版每月10美元。对预算有限的独立开发者来说,这是个实打实的优势。
我的使用建议
讲讲我现在的实际配置。
日常开发用Cursor,因为交互体验最好,效率最高。写新功能、修bug、做重构,Cursor的Composer处理这些都很顺手。
遇到特别复杂的问题或者需要跨大范围重构时,切到Claude Code。它的深度推理能力在处理”大手术”级别的改动时更靠谱。
Copilot我保留了订阅,主要用在写快速脚本和处理GitHub工作流的时候。它的inline补全在写样板代码时还是很顺手。
关于成本的一点算账
独立开发者得算清楚工具成本。我上个月三个工具的支出大概是:Cursor Pro 20美元,Claude Code按API用量大概85美元,Copilot 10美元。加起来115美元/月。
这个数字乍看不少,但考虑到AI工具帮我省下的时间,ROI是正的。以前一个功能写两天,现在半天能搞定。省下的时间用来做用户调研、写文档、或者干脆休息。
如果你预算有限只能选一个,我建议Cursor。它的综合体验最好,20美元/月的定价对独立开发者来说比较合理。
写在最后
AI编程工具这个领域变化太快了。我写这篇文章的时候,三家都在快速迭代。下个月可能又是另一番景象。
但有一件事我觉得不会变:工具终究是工具,核心还是你自己的技术判断力。AI能帮你写代码,但架构决策、产品方向、用户需求理解,这些还得靠人。
选一个顺手的工具,然后把精力放在真正重要的事情上。
